Investigation of transport-relevant fluctuations in the plasma boundary of ASDEX

Description

After the discussion of plasma diagnostics the local radial particle flux in the plasma edge is described, followed by a treatment of the density and potential fluctuations in the boundary zone. A statistical analysis determines the correlation lengths of the observed fluctuations in directions poloidal, radial and parallel to the magnetic field. Power density spectra and coherent spectra lead to better understanding of the fluctuations. The asymmetry of the fluctuation amplitude between high and low field side of the torus has been observed in a tokamak for the first time. Furtheron the dependence of the fluctuation properties on global plasma parameters is examined, together with the extremely high flucutations' correlation along the magnetic field lines. The response of the fluctuations to additional heating by neutral beam injection is elaborated, especially in the H-mode of better plasma confinement. ASDEX fluctuations are compared with such of other machines, followed by a survey of the manifold instabilities and their properties. The appendix discusses the divertor tokamak ASDEX and the applied statistical methods. (AH)
